Direct API-Database Coupling vs. Multi-Layered Architectures

API-database coupling vs. traditional multi-layered architectures: what’s the difference and why does it matter? The main difference between direct API-database coupling and multi-layered architectures is that the former allows the API to interact directly with the database, minimizing latency and complexity, while the latter uses multiple layers to separate concerns.

The Real-World Impact of Shift-Left

To shift or not to shift – that is the question. If you’ve been around the software development world lately, you’ve likely heard of shift-left – the practice of integrating testing, security, and operations early in the software development lifecycle to detect issues early. This approach is meant to be a win-win-win – saving time, money, and headaches. But is it as great in practice as it sounds in theory? Debugging in Ruby with pry-byebug

For a software engineer, even the basic use of a debugger can save a lot of pain: adding breakpoints (places in the code the program will stop at and expose the current context) is very easy, and navigating from one breakpoint to another isn't difficult either. And with just that, you can say goodbye to a program's many puts and runs. Just add one or more breakpoints and run your program.
